Ribeira Sacra
This region encompasses 15 municipalities in the provinces of Lugo and Orense, housing 5 subzones and an impressive 50 bodegas. It's a place where indigenous grape varieties and breathtaking terroirs come together.
The Wines
From white monovarietals to robust red wines, Ribeira Sacra's wines are unique and delightful. Mencía, godello, albariño, and treixadura are among the favorites.
The Climate
A stark contrast between the two valleys, Valle del Sil and Valle del Miño, yields diverse flavor profiles in the wines.
Terroir
The vineyards, spanning 1550 hectares, are terraced on the slopes of the rivers Sil and Miño valleys. The landscape is awe-inspiring, but the harvest is as challenging as in some parts of the Mosel Valley.
